normad wrote
> Hello,
>
> I tried installing io-2.2.7 on octave 4.0.0 on windows and i get the
> following warnings.
>
> warning: (Automatic loading of spreadsheet I/O Java classlibs failed)
> warning: Couldn't remove spreadsheet I/O javaclasspath entries while
> unloading io pkg
> For information about changes from previous versions of the io package,
> run 'news io'.
>
> and this warning on startup
>
> warning: (Automatic loading of spreadsheet I/O Java classlibs failed)
>
> and xlsread function doesnt work. undefined. please help
See http://savannah.gnu.org/bugs/index.php?45243
As the spreadsheet functions will be moved into core Octave shortly
(development version), I think the lead dev accidentally included his
working version of the io package in the installer.
Indeed, "pkg install -forge io" will do the trick.
